Partnership & LLC Taxation. The at-risk rules of Sec. 465 originated with the enactment of the Tax Reform Act of 1976, P.L. 94-455. It was a time of 70% tax rates, when tax shelters were aggressively marketed to manipulate taxable income. Originally, the rules applied only to certain narrowly defined types of activities, but subsequent ...

WebApr 1, 2024 · 465 - 38 (a) provides rules for the ordering of allowable deductions, prioritizing the deduction of capital and Sec. 1231 losses over ordinary and tax - preferred losses. The instructions to Form 6198, At-Risk Limitations, however, indicate that losses of differing character are instead to be disallowed on a pro rata basis.
